How We Tackle Broken Pipe Water Damage
Dealing with a broken pipe requires more than just mopping up water. It demands a systematic approach to ensure every bit of moisture is removed and your home’s structure is sound. Cutting corners here can lead to costly repairs down the line, including mold remediation and structural reinforcement. We follow a proven procedure, honed over years of service in the area, to get your property back to pre-loss conditions safely and efficiently, working with your insurance every step of the way.
1. Immediate Water Extraction
Once we arrive, our first priority is removing all standing water. We use powerful truck-mounted or portable extraction units to remove bulk water from carpets, floors, and furniture as quickly as possible. This step is critical to prevent water from seeping deeper into your subfloors and walls.
2. Structural Drying and Dehumidification
After the bulk water is gone, we set up specialized drying equipment, including high-capacity dehumidifiers and powerful air movers. These machines work tirelessly to reduce humidity levels and dry out the affected materials. This process can take several days, depending on the extent of the damage.
3. Content Cleaning and Restoration
We carefully assess your belongings, including furniture, documents, and personal items. Items that can be salvaged will be moved to a secure, climate-controlled facility for professional cleaning and restoration, ensuring they are returned to their original condition whenever possible.
4. Mold Prevention and Inspection
Standing water creates an ideal environment for mold growth. Our technicians conduct thorough inspections for any signs of mold and implement preventative treatments in affected areas. We monitor the drying process closely to ensure a healthy environment is maintained.
5. Reconstruction and Repair
Once drying is complete and the structure is confirmed to be dry, we begin any necessary repairs. This might include replacing drywall, repairing flooring, or repainting. Our goal is to restore your home to its pre-damage state, making it safe and comfortable again.

Warning Signs You Need Broken Pipe Water Damage Restoration
Catching the signs of water damage early can save you a lot of trouble and money. Ignoring small leaks or damp spots can lead to much bigger problems, like warped floors and hidden mold infestations. Being aware of what to look for is your first line of defense in protecting your property in the area.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ent, damp, or musty smell, especially in areas where you don’t expect moisture, is a strong indicator of water damage. It often means water has been sitting long enough to start causing biological growth.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for brown or yellow stains on ceilings, walls, or floors. These marks are a clear sign that water has saturated the material and is likely causing damage from within.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per
When moisture gets behind paint or wallpaper, it loosens the adhesive and can cause the surface to bubble or peel away from the wall. This is a direct sign of water intrusion.
Warped or Sagging Ceilings and Walls
Structural materials like drywall and wood can absorb water and lose their integrity. This can lead to visible sagging or warping, indicating serious saturation.
Unexplained Dampness or Soft Spots on Floors
If your floors feel unusually soft, spongy, or damp to the touch, especially near plumbing fixtures or walls, it’s a sign that water is trapped beneath the surface, potentially causing subfloor damage.
Increased Water Bill or Low Water Pressure
A sudden spike in your water bill or a noticeable drop in water pressure throughout your home can indicate an undetected leak within your plumbing system, leading to ongoing water loss.
Broken Pipe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or spill from a leaky faucet | Yes, with towels and fans. | No. | Easy to manage and dry with household items. |
| Small puddle after a pipe freezes and thaws | Maybe, if very contained. | Yes. | Hidden moisture can spread quickly; professional drying is more effective. |
| Water spraying from a burst pipe in a wall | No. | Yes. | Requires immediate shut-off, water extraction, and structural drying to prevent mold. |
| Flooded basement from a broken main line | No. | Yes. | Extensive water requires commercial equipment and expertise for proper drying and safety. |
| Damp spots on ceiling after a toilet supply line leak | No. | Yes. | Water in ceilings can indicate widespread saturation and potential structural compromise. |
| Water damage under a sink from a minor drip | Possibly, if dried immediately. | Yes. | Cabinet interiors can harbor moisture leading to mold, so thorough drying is best. |
While small spills might be manageable, anything involving water inside walls, ceilings, or spreading across large floor areas demands professional attention. Broken Pipe Water Damage Restoration Cost In Pinecrest, FL
The cost for broken pipe water damage restoration in Pinecrest, FL, can vary significantly based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and how quickly the issue was addressed. These figures are estimates to give you a general idea. Insurance coverage often plays a role in the final out-of-pocket expense for homeowners.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Volume of water, accessibility, and urgency. |
| Structural Drying &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000+ | Square footage, drying time required, and equipment needed. |
| Content Cleaning & Restoration | $300 – $3,000+ | Number and type of items requiring specialized cleaning. |
| Mold Prevention/Treatment | $500 – $2,000 | Size of area treated and type of preventative or treatment solution used. |
| Minor Structural Repairs (e.g., drywall) | $750 – $3,000+ | Extent of damage, materials needed, and labor involved. |
| Detailed Documentation for Insurance | Included in overall service cost | Comprehensive reports and drying logs are standard. |

Common Questions About Broken Pipe Water Damage Restoration
What’s the first thing I should do if I suspect a broken pipe?
The absolute first step is to locate the main water shut-off valve for your home and turn it off immediately to stop the flow of water. Then, you should call a professional restoration company. We can help assess the damage and begin the drying process, which is critical for preventing further issues like mold.
How long does it take to dry out a home after a broken pipe?
Drying times vary greatly depending on the extent of the water damage, the materials affected, and your home’s construction. Typically, it can take anywhere from three days to two weeks for thorough drying. We use specialized equipment to speed up this process significantly, providing you with regular updates.
Will my insurance company cover broken pipe water damage?
In most cases, yes, homeowners insurance policies cover damage caused by sudden and accidental bursts or leaks from plumbing systems. However, coverage for gradual leaks or damage due to poor maintenance might be excluded. How do you prevent mold after a pipe bursts?
Preventing mold is a major focus of our restoration process. We use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to rapidly reduce moisture levels in the air and building materials. We also apply antimicrobial treatments to affected areas to inhibit mold growth. Continuous monitoring ensures the environment is unfavorable for mold.
What kind of equipment do you use for broken pipe water damage?
We utilize a range of professional-grade equipment, including powerful water extractors, high-volume air movers, industrial dehumidifiers, moisture meters to detect hidden dampness, and thermal imaging cameras to identify water intrusion. This advanced technology allows us to dry your property effectively and efficiently, often much faster than conventional methods.
